This warning shows up because the app isn’t codesigned. You can purchase a codesigning certificate, but it’s much more expensive than publishing on Steam which bypasses codesigning warnings. Publishing to Steam costs $100 (which is refunded after your project generates $1,500 of sales), while a codesigning certificate is easily $500 per year.
